Conquering Metal Slicing with Your Miter Device
Working with alloys can be challenging if you don’t utilize the correct techniques. Your miter saw is a versatile instrument for producing clean, exact cuts, but demands a few particular considerations. First , ensure your cutting disc is specifically designed for non-ferrous stock; using a wood blade will cause a torn edge and likely kickback. In addition, lower your advance considerably – forcing the stock through too rapidly can cause warping. Be sure to steady the metal securely to avoid vibration and provide a clean cut.
- Use a wet agent, like lubricant , to reduce friction and warmth.
- Inspect your insert frequently for dullness and replace it as necessary.
- Rehearse on sample metal before facing your actual project.
